Description Suggest change

Start up a short, left-leaning corner, then move right into a steep flared corner with a thin finger crack on its left. At the top of the corner, step up left past a bolt, then pull the left end of the overhang. The start is mossy and takes a while to dry.

Location Suggest change

Head through the big chimney behind the pillar and crawl out its right (east) side. A three-trunked oak marks the start of the route.

Protection Suggest change

Light rack to 2", one protection bolt, two-bolt anchor.
